Two accidents in Frederick Street
Wednesday September 23, 2009
Emergency services attended two motor vehicle accidents in Frederick Street last Tuesday night.
The first accident occurred at 5.20pm when the 40 year old male driver of a Falcon utility failed to give way at the intersection of Bradley and Frederick streets and collided with a Nissan 4WD travelling along Frederick Street causing it to veer off the road, spin around and come to rest on the footpath outside a residence.
The 47 year old female driver and her female passenger were treated at the scene for minor injuries before both being conveyed to hospital.
The passenger of the vehicle remained in hospital for observation overnight and was released the next day.
Both vehicles were towed from the scene and the male driver was issued with an infringement notice for negligent driving.
The second accident occurred shortly after at 6.20pm when a prime mover hit a power pole in Frederick Street.
The 51 year male driver of the prime mover was uninjured as a result of the accident.
The vehicle sustained minor damage however there were disruptions to power for approximately one and a half hours while Country Energy staff repaired power lines.
